Re-Adoption Day!
Today I went to court in Annapolis, MD to stand before a judge to re-adopt Jacob. This was a vastly different experience than my appearance in Shymkent where they asked me a bunch of questions. Rather than the stern, somber experience, the re-adoption was a joyful fun occasion (they even let us take pictures in the court room). And this time was made even more special because I had my friends and family there with me.

One Year Ago Today
I can't believe that one year ago today I was in Shymkent, Kazakhstan meeting my beautiful, amazing little boy. I was so nervous when we walked into the baby house. I didn't know what to expect. They ushered us into the Baby House Director's office and we sat there for a few minutes in silence. The Baby House Doctor came in and began to tell us about Jacob then a few minutes later they brought him in and sat him in my lap. It was so hard to pay attention to what the Doctor was saying once I had him - thank goodness my sister was with me so she could take notes. In the middle of going through his information a man and a woman came in and began to yell at the doctor - it was very surreal. My sister, Jake and I just sat there and didn't know what to make of it. Our coordinator later explained that the man and woman had a sick child and were upset that they couldn't leave the child at the baby house (the doctor didn't want this child to make the other children sick). After they left we finished getting Jake's information and then they let us take Jake to a small room just outside the Director's office for a few minutes to take some pictures.
